Shake Table Tests of Reinforced Concrete Flat Plate Frames and Post-tensioned Flat Plate Frames
A research study was undertaken to assess performance of flat plate systems constructed with slab shear reinforcement under dynamic loads. The research program consisted of shake table tests and accompanying analytical studies of two, approximately one-third scale, two-story, two-bay, slab-column frames. متن کاملDynamic testing of a four-storey building with reinforced concrete and unreinforced masonry walls: prediction, test results and data set
This paper presents the results of a series of shake-table tests on a half-scale, four-storey building with reinforced concrete and unreinforced masonry walls. Due to the lack of reference tests, the seismic behaviour of such mixed structures is poorly understood.
